<nav> </nav>上的字体系列属性

时间:2014-10-27 15:41:05

标签: html5

好的,我尝试更改&lt; nav&gt;中的font-family。标签,它不会改变,我尝试了另一种字体属性,如font-weight,font-style,font-size,它的工作方式,但字体系列。为什么这发生了?我无法弄明白。

这是html:

<!DOCTYPE html>
<html lang="en">

<head>
    <meta charset="utf-8">
    <link rel="stylesheet" type="text/css" href="css.css" media="screen">
    <title>One Piece | Petualangan Tiada Akhir</title>
</head>
<body>
    <div>
        <header>
            <hgroup>
                <h1>One Piece : Petualangan Tiada Akhir</h1>
                <h2>Luffy dan Kawan-Kawan Mugiwara Pirates</h2>
            </hgroup>
            <nav>
                <ul>
                    <li><a href="#">beranda</a></li>
                    <li><a href="#">daftar isi</a></li>
                    <li><a href="#">kontak</a></li>
                    <li><a href="#">profil</a></li>
                    <li><a href="#">privacy</a></li>
                    <li><a href="#">disclaimer</a></li>
                </ul>
            </nav>
        </header>
        <section>
          <h2>Section</h2>
        </section>
        <footer>
           <small>&copy; Contoh Makalah Mahasiswa Font: Oswald, Source Sans Pro Powered by Blogger Template by :]</small>
        </footer>
   </div>
</body>
</html>

现在的CSS:

*{
  font-family:calibri;
  margin:0px;
  padding:0px;
}

header{
  padding:10px;
  margin-left:auto;
  margin-right:auto;
  background-color:#0fcdcf;
}

header h1{
  text-transform:uppercase;
  font-size:2.5em;
  font-family:Imprint MT Shadow;
}

header h2{
  font-size:1.5em;
  font-family:Giddyup Std;
}

nav{
  padding-top:10px;
  text-transform:uppercase;
  font-size:0.9em;
  font-family:times new roman;
  font-weight:bold;
  font-style:normal;
 }

nav li{
  list-style-type:none;
  margin-right:5px;
  display:inline;
}

body{
  background-color:#d7d5e0;
}   

div{
  width:80%;    
  margin-left:auto;
  margin-right:auto;
  box-shadow:10px 5px 10px #888888;
}

section{
  padding:10px;
  margin-left:auto;
  margin-right:auto;
  background-color:white;
}

footer{
  padding:10px;
  margin-left:auto;
  margin-right:auto;
  background-color:white;
}

提前致谢。

2 个答案:

答案 0 :(得分:1)

要使上面的示例正常工作,请选择一个标记并更改其工作的字体名称,我想应用字体系列应该在该元素中存在一些文本

nav li a{
    font-family:arial;
}

答案 1 :(得分:0)

您应该显示您的代码。 无论如何,这应该工作:

<nav style="font-family: xxx;">